4. How to Find the GCF of 4533 and 4539?

Answer:

Greatest Common Factor of 4533 and 4539 = 3

Step 1: Find the prime factorization of 4533

4533 = 3 x 1511

Step 2: Find the prime factorization of 4539

4539 = 3 x 17 x 89

Step 3: Multiply those factors both numbers have in common in steps i) or ii) above to find the gcf:

GCF = 3

Step 4: Therefore, the greatest common factor of 4533 and 4539 is 3
